    Re: Dr. Strangelove

    One of the great cold war satires ever. You should rent (I believe it's on DVD) Fail-Safe. It takes generally the same premise but does it in all dead seriousness. Henry Fonda was terrific as well as a young Larry Hagman.

    Watch Fail-Safe first then watch Dr Strangelove and the biting satire and spoofery will come out more but then you'll realize that it was a topic that was very taboo to be joking around with.

    Oh and Fail-Safe contains one of the more sobering ends to a movie i've ever seen.
